EEE-HB0G470R Equivalent & Substitute Parts

Part Overview

The EEE-HB0G470R is a 47 µF, 4 V aluminum electrolytic capacitor in surface mount radial can package manufactured by Panasonic Electronic Components. This component is rated for automotive applications with AEC-Q200 compliance and operates across -40°C to 105°C with a 2000-hour lifetime at 105°C. Substitute Part Grouping Explanation

Substitution eligibility for the EEE-HB0G470R is determined by the following criteria:

Direct Substitutes maintain identical capacitance (47 µF), tolerance (±20%), package geometry (0.157" diameter, 5.80mm height), surface mount land size (4.30mm × 4.30mm), and mounting configuration. Voltage rating may be equal or higher. These parts are interchangeable without circuit redesign.

Upgrade Substitutes increase voltage rating from 4 V to 6.3 V while maintaining all other mechanical and electrical parameters. Higher voltage rating provides additional design margin and is backward compatible in applications designed for 4 V operation.

Similar Substitutes increase voltage rating to 16 V, representing a significant voltage upgrade. These parts maintain identical capacitance, tolerance, and package footprint but may have different product status classifications.

All substitute candidates must maintain:

  • 47 µF capacitance value
  • ±20% tolerance
  • Surface mount radial can package
  • 0.157" (4.00mm) diameter
  • 4.30mm × 4.30mm land size
  • AEC-Q200 automotive rating
  • ROHS3 compliance
  • Polar configuration

Engineering Selection Recommendations

Primary Substitutes (Direct Replacement)

EEE-HBJ470UAR is the recommended primary substitute. It maintains the same HB series platform as the original part, identical operating temperature range (-40°C to 105°C), and matching mechanical dimensions (5.80mm height). The 6.3 V rating provides voltage margin while remaining fully compatible with 4 V circuit designs. Product status is Active with 6491 units in inventory.

Secondary Substitutes (Voltage Upgrade)

EEE-FPJ470UAR and 6.3TZV47M4X6.1 both provide 6.3 V ratings with extended operating temperature range (-55°C to 105°C). EEE-FPJ470UAR maintains the 5.80mm height of the original part. The Rubycon 6.3TZV47M4X6.1 offers an alternative manufacturer source with equivalent electrical specifications. Both are Active status parts with substantial inventory availability.

Higher Voltage Alternatives

EEE-FT1C470AR (16 V, Active status, 39199 units) and EEE-FK1C470SR (16 V, Not For New Designs status) represent significant voltage upgrades suitable for applications requiring enhanced voltage margin. EEE-FT1C470AR is preferred due to Active product status. Both parts increase height to 6.10mm, requiring PCB layout verification.

EEE-FKJ470UAR (6.3 V, Active status) bridges the voltage and height specifications, offering 6.3 V rating with 6.10mm height and extended temperature range (-55°C to 105°C).

Compliance Considerations

All substitute parts maintain AEC-Q200 automotive rating, ROHS3 compliance, and MSL Level 1 (Unlimited) moisture sensitivity. All are suitable for automotive applications without additional qualification requirements.

Frequently Asked Questions (FAQ)

Q: Can EEE-HBJ470UAR directly replace EEE-HB0G470R without PCB modification?

A: Yes. EEE-HBJ470UAR maintains identical package dimensions (0.157" diameter, 5.80mm height) and surface mount land size (4.30mm × 4.30mm). The 6.3 V rating is backward compatible with 4 V circuit designs. No PCB layout changes are required.

Q: What is the difference between the 5.80mm and 6.10mm height variants?

A: EEE-HB0G470R, EEE-FPJ470UAR maintain 5.80mm seated height. EEE-FKJ470UAR, EEE-FK1C470SR, EEE-FT1C470AR, and 6.3TZV47M4X6.1 have 6.10mm seated height. The 0.30mm height increase requires verification of available PCB clearance in the component mounting area.

Q: Why is EEE-FK1C470SR marked "Not For New Designs"?

A: This product status indicates Panasonic has designated this part for legacy support only. While functionally equivalent and in stock, new designs should select Active status alternatives such as EEE-FT1C470AR for long-term supply assurance.

Q: Are there manufacturer differences between Panasonic and Rubycon parts?

A: 6.3TZV47M4X6.1 is manufactured by Rubycon while all other listed parts are Panasonic products. Both manufacturers provide AEC-Q200 rated automotive-grade aluminum electrolytic capacitors with equivalent electrical specifications. Rubycon parts offer alternative sourcing for supply chain diversification.

Q: What is the impact of voltage rating increase on circuit performance?

A: Higher voltage ratings (6.3 V or 16 V) provide additional design margin and do not negatively impact circuits designed for lower voltages. The capacitance value (47 µF) and tolerance (±20%) remain constant across all substitutes, ensuring equivalent circuit behavior.
